Beer
Beer is an alcoholic beverage produced by the fermentation of cereal grains, primarily barley, though wheat, maize, and rice are also used. The brewing process involves the conversion of starches into sugars, which are then fermented by yeast. Hops are commonly added for bitterness, flavor, and preservation. Beer is one of the oldest and most widely consumed alcoholic drinks in the world, with numerous styles such as lager, ale, stout, and pilsner. It typically contains 3–12% alcohol by volume.
